Typhoon Haiyan (or Typhoon Yolanda in the Philippines) is the number one of the strongest tropical cyclones in history. It formed on November 2, 2013, in the western Pacific Ocean.
It began east-southeast of Pohnpei. The storm later hit the Philippines with extremely high winds and a strong storm surge. It has caused major damage in the Visayas. Hundreds of people have died in the storm. The strongest tropical system to reach land. Haiyan's winds were near 195 miles an hour.
At least 6,000 to 10,000 people plus lost their lives and over 1 million-plus people's homes were damaged, displacing over 600,000 people and a damage of $2.98 billion (2013 USD)
